计算机系统的性能监控是每个用户和管理员都应该重视的任务。了解系统资源的占用情况,不仅能帮助用户优化系统性能,还能在出现故障时迅速定位问题。本文将介绍几种有效的工具和方法,帮助你全面分析系统资源使用情况,并提供一些实用的优化建议和技巧。

对于Windows用户,任务管理器是一个基本而强大的工具。通过快捷键Ctrl + Shift + Esc,可以直接打开任务管理器。这里,可以看到CPU、内存、磁盘和网络的实时使用情况。任务管理器的性能标签下,可以查看各项资源的详细信息,而进程标签则列出了所有运行的程序及其资源占用情况,便于识别高资源消耗的进程。如需更深入的分析,Windows系统自带的资源监视器(Resource Monitor)更能够提供详细的CPU、内存、磁盘和网络的活动情况,从而进行更深入的排查。
对于Linux用户,可以使用命令行工具如`top`和`htop`。`top`命令提供了实时的系统信息,显示各进程的CPU和内存使用情况,同时支持按不同方式排序。`htop`是一个更为友好的版本,除了基本的资源监控外,还支持通过颜***分不同类型的资源占用,使得观察更加直观。使用这些工具,你可以快速识别和处理高资源占用的进程。
Mac用户则可以通过活动监视器来查看系统资源使用情况。与Windows的任务管理器类似,活动监视器提供了各项资源的实时数据,包括CPU、内存、能量和磁盘等。活动监视器还可以显示每个应用程序的详细信息,帮助用户定位性能瓶颈。
除了系统自带的工具,还有一些专业的第三方软件可以更全面地分析系统资源。例如,Process Explorer是微软提供的一个强大工具,它比任务管理器提供了更多的信息和细致的控制。通过Process Explorer,用户可以深入查看每一个进程的句柄、DLL文件以及它们所占用的资源,极大地帮助开发者或系统管理员进行精细化的资源管理。
在监控系统资源的优化系统性能也是十分重要的一环。定期清理临时文件,优化启动项,或升级硬件组件,都是提高系统性能的有效方法。如果是DIY组装电脑的用户,可以选择适合自己需求的高性能CPU、SSD和大容量内存,从而显著提升计算机的运行速度和响应能力。
对于需要频繁使用图形软件、游戏或进行数据分析的用户,了解图形和计算资源的占用情况尤其重要。可以通过GPU-Z等工具监控显卡的使用率和温度,确保显卡在高负载下不会过热或受到性能限制。
随着技术的发展,例如云计算和边缘计算的兴起,资源占用的监测和优化变得愈发重要。无论是在个人电脑还是服务器上,利用合适的工具分析和优化资源使用,将关系到系统的稳定性和效率。
常见问题解答
1. 如何打开Windows任务管理器?
通过按下Ctrl + Shift + Esc快捷键可以直接打开任务管理器。
2. 什么是`top`命令?
`top`是Linux下的一个命令行工具,可以实时显示系统资源的使用情况,让用户监控各进程的CPU和内存占用。
3. 有哪些工具可以监控GPU的使用情况?
GPU-Z是一个流行的工具,可以帮助用户监控显卡的使用率和温度。
4. 如何优化系统启动项?
在Windows中,可以通过任务管理器的启动标签管理开机自动启动的程序。禁用不必要的项目可以加快系统启动速度。
5. Linux中如何安装`htop`?
可以通过包管理器(如apt或yum)安装`htop`,例如在终端中输入`sudo apt install htop`。
通过适当的工具和有效的优化策略,不仅可以了解系统资源的使用情况,还能在实际使用中提升计算机的整体性能。